Is Noida better than Gurgaon?

Noida is better planned, in terms of physical and social infrastructure. Gurgaon has a bigger and better entertainment hub, such as DLF Cyber Hub, Sector-29, etc. Noida is comparatively more affordable for renters and home buyers. Gurgaon has more premium property options from a number of branded developers.

Is Noida cheaper than Delhi?

Cost of Living Comparison Between Noida and Delhi You would need around 129,481.03₹ in Delhi to maintain the same standard of life that you can have with 130,000.00₹ in Noida (assuming you rent in both cities). This calculation uses our Cost of Living Plus Rent Index to compare cost of living.

What is the crime rate in Noida?

Crime rates in Noida, India

Level of crime 66.81 High
Problem people using or dealing drugs 41.56 Moderate
Problem property crimes such as vandalism and theft 59.93 Moderate
Problem violent crimes such as assault and armed robbery 59.00 Moderate
Problem corruption and bribery 72.44 High

Does Noida have hard water?

Ground water of Noida City is hard in few pockets. Two common minerals in the Noida soil – magnesium and calcium – dissolve in the water to create “hard water” in Noida, hardness ranges from 108 mg/l to 838 mg/l depending on the water sources. Hard water poses no health risk but can be troublesome to consumer.

Which city is more expensive Bangalore or Noida?

Cost of Living Comparison Between Noida and Bangalore You would need around 128,690.63₹ in Bangalore to maintain the same standard of life that you can have with 130,000.00₹ in Noida (assuming you rent in both cities). This calculation uses our Cost of Living Plus Rent Index to compare cost of living.
